Southern Illinois University Edwardsville cost by family income

These are the average out-of-pocket costs after grants and scholarships, based on U.S. Department of Education reporting.

Family income $0 - $30,000 $7,459/yr
Family income $30,001 - $48,000 $9,208/yr
Family income $48,001 - $75,000 $11,954/yr
Family income $75,001 - $110,000 $18,190/yr

Low-income families under $30k pay an average of $7,459 per year. This band often benefits most from Pell Grants and institutional aid.

Frequently Asked Questions about Southern Illinois University Edwardsville

What is the acceptance rate at Southern Illinois University Edwardsville?

Southern Illinois University Edwardsville has an acceptance rate of 97.2%, making it an accessible institution with moderate admissions standards.

How much is tuition at Southern Illinois University Edwardsville?

Tuition at Southern Illinois University Edwardsville is $12,922 per year. Net price and financial aid options may reduce this cost significantly depending on individual circumstances.

What is the average salary for graduates of Southern Illinois University Edwardsville?

Graduates of Southern Illinois University Edwardsville earn a median salary of $56,346 per year, based on 2026 U.S. Department of Education earnings data.
